Kim Kardashian
Kimberly Noel Kardashian West (née Kardashian; born October 21, 1980) is an American media personality, model, businesswoman, socialite and actress. Kardashian first gained media attention as a friend and stylist of Paris Hilton but received wider notice after a 2002 sex tape, Kim Kardashian, Superstar, with her then-boyfriend Ray J was released in 2007. Later that year, she and her family began to appear in the E! reality television series Keeping Up with the Kardashians (2007–present). Its success soon led to the creation of spin-offs including Kourtney and Kim Take New York (2011–2012) and Kourtney and Kim Take Miami (2009–2013).

There's a real buzz in the air at West Lothian primary school

There’s a buzz in the air at Dedridge Primary School.That’s because pupils have been learning all about biodiversity and ecology in a new project, which included planting areas of pollinator-friendly flowers and six fruit trees, to attract bees.The project was run by The Centre, Livingston and the charity, RePollinate, which helps improve education on the importance of pollinators and how to protect them.The project, which is the first of its kind, was delivered by ecologist Nick Trull from RePollinate, who worked closely with teacher Mrs Mohammed and a small group of ASL (Additional Support for Learning) pupils, using an outdoor learning approach with play based activities, and lots of props including pollinator costumes.
